Income Statement Key Figures
ⓘRevenue and Revenue Growth
Revenue is the starting point of every income statement — it measures the total sales 3D Systems generates from its core business. Revenue growth (expressed as year-over-year percentage change) is one of the most important indicators of business momentum. Sustained growth above 10 % annually is generally considered strong, while declining revenue is a serious warning sign that demands investigation.
Gross Margin
Gross margin = (Revenue − Cost of Goods Sold) ÷ Revenue. It reveals what percentage of each dollar of revenue 3D Systems retains after direct production costs. High gross margins (above 50 %) are typical of asset-light businesses like software and brands, while capital-intensive industries like manufacturing often operate below 30 %. Compare 3D Systems's gross margin to industry peers and track it over time to spot improving or deteriorating pricing power.
EBIT and EBIT Margin
EBIT measures operating profit — what remains after subtracting all operating expenses (including R&D, sales, and administrative costs) from gross profit. The EBIT margin shows this as a percentage of revenue. Because it excludes interest and taxes, EBIT allows fair comparisons between companies with different debt levels and tax jurisdictions. A rising EBIT margin indicates improving operational efficiency.
Net Income and Earnings Per Share (EPS)
Net income is the company's final profit after all expenses, interest, and taxes. Dividing net income by the number of shares outstanding gives you EPS — the single most influential metric in stock valuation. Consistent EPS growth is the primary driver of long-term stock price appreciation. Always check whether EPS growth comes from genuine profit improvement or from share buybacks reducing the share count.
Shares Outstanding
The total number of shares 3D Systems has issued. A declining share count (through buybacks) boosts EPS and signals management confidence. A rising share count (through stock issuance) dilutes existing shareholders. Always monitor this number alongside EPS to get the full picture of per-share value creation.
Analyst Estimates
The projected figures represent consensus estimates from professional analysts. Compare these forecasts against 3D Systems's historical growth rates to assess whether expectations are realistic. A company that consistently beats consensus estimates tends to see its stock price rewarded over time, while repeated misses erode investor confidence.

Fair Value Estimate
ⓘWhat Is Fair Value?
Fair value is an estimate of what a stock is truly "worth" based on its financial fundamentals, independent of the current market price. If the calculated fair value is above the current share price, the stock may be undervalued — and vice versa. This chart shows three different fair value approaches so you can cross-check them against each other.
Earnings-Based Fair Value
Calculated by multiplying the current earnings per share (EPS) by the average historical P/E ratio over a selected multi-year period. The smoothing over several years filters out temporary spikes or dips. If this fair value exceeds the market price, it suggests the stock is cheap relative to its earning power.
Example: Fair Value (Earnings) 2022 = EPS 2022 × Average P/E 2019–2021
Revenue-Based Fair Value
Derived by multiplying revenue per share by the average historical price-to-sales ratio. This method is particularly useful for companies with volatile or temporarily depressed earnings, as revenue tends to be more stable than profits. It answers: "At what price has the market historically valued each dollar of this company's sales?"
Example: Fair Value (Revenue) 2022 = Revenue per Share 2022 × Average P/S 2019–2021
Dividend-Based Fair Value
Calculated by dividing the dividend per share by the average historical dividend yield. This approach is most relevant for mature, consistently dividend-paying companies. If the resulting fair value is higher than the current price, it implies the stock offers a better yield than its historical average.
Example: Fair Value (Dividend) 2022 = Dividend per Share 2022 ÷ Average Yield 2019–2021
How to Use This Chart
When all three fair value lines converge above the current price, it strengthens the case that the stock is undervalued. When they diverge, investigate why — it may indicate a structural shift in margins, payout policy, or growth rate. The forward estimates on the right extend the analysis using projected fundamentals, helping you assess whether the current price already reflects future growth expectations.

3D Systems Corp is primarily active in the industries of manufacturing, healthcare, and aerospace.
The main competitors of 3D Systems Corp in the market are Stratasys, Ltd. and HP Inc.
3D Systems Corp is a renowned company in the field of 3D printing. Founded in 1986, it has a rich history and extensive experience in additive manufacturing technology. The company focuses on developing cutting-edge solutions for industrial, healthcare, and consumer markets. With a wide range of innovative products like 3D printers, materials, and software, 3D Systems Corp has established itself as a global leader in additive manufacturing. They have consistently pushed boundaries and revolutionized various industries with their advanced technologies, making them a trusted and influential player in the 3D printing space.
Some significant milestones achieved by 3D Systems Corp include pioneering the 3D printing industry, introducing the first commercial 3D printer, and developing innovative technologies such as Stereolithography and Selective Laser Sintering. The company has expanded its portfolio through strategic acquisitions, enabling it to offer a wide range of products and services in the 3D printing ecosystem. 3D Systems Corp has also collaborated with various industries, including healthcare, aerospace, and automotive, to revolutionize manufacturing processes and bring forth advanced solutions. Additionally, the company has received several prestigious awards for its contributions in the field of 3D printing technology.
3D Systems Corp is primarily present in the United States, with its headquarters located in Rock Hill, South Carolina. 3D Systems Corp is an American company headquartered in South Carolina. The company is a global leader in the development, production, and marketing of 3D printers and 3D printing materials. Its main business is the manufacturing of machines and accessories for additive manufacturing. The company is divided into several business divisions specializing in different application areas: - Healthcare Solutions: This division develops and markets 3D Systems products for medical use. For example, personalized medical implants are manufactured and orthodontic devices are printed. - Industrial Solutions: 3D Systems focuses on the use of 3D printing technology for industrial manufacturing in this division. This includes prototyping, small production runs, and custom manufacturing of spare parts. - Aerospace & Defense Solutions: This division specializes in manufacturing aerospace and defense industry parts and custom components. In addition to these main business divisions, 3D Systems also offers services to engineers and designers to support 3D printing and provide application-specific solutions. The company has a strong network of partners and resellers worldwide and offers training and support programs for customers and partners. 3D Systems offers a wide range of 3D printers and materials tailored to customer needs. The products range from low-end desktop printers for the education sector to high-end machines suitable for specialized professional applications such as aerospace or medicine. The range of materials includes plastics, metals, ceramics, and composites to enable a wide range of applications. To ensure that customers achieve the desired results, the company also provides software tailored to customer needs. 3D Systems has diverse business relationships. The company works closely with customers, distributors, contractors, and suppliers to bring products to market quickly and effectively. 3D Systems also collaborates with research institutes and universities to further develop technology and expertise. In summary, 3D Systems is a company specialized in various business fields. It offers a complete solution that supports customers in improving necessary manufacturing methods. The company has strong partnerships, a broad network, and high expertise, thus holding a leading position in the global market for 3D printing technology.
